WebFeb 25, 2024 · A large portosystemic shunt may persist after a liver transplant which can cause hepatic encephalopathy with or without cirrhosis. Moreover, LT recipients can develop graft cirrhosis and portal hypertension related to SPSS which could be present before a live transplant or newly developed posttransplant. WebMar 16, 2024 · Cirrhosis is caused by chronic (long-term) liver diseases that damage liver tissue. It can take many years for liver damage to lead to cirrhosis. Chronic Alcoholism. Chronic alcoholism is one of the leading causes of cirrhosis in the United States. Drinking too much alcohol can cause the liver to swell, which over time can lead to cirrhosis. Indications The most common indications for liver transplantation in the United States are hepatitis C virus (30%) and alcoholic liver disease (18%). ... Graft reinfection with hepatitis C virus (HCV) is very common, occurring in 50-80% of ...

WebCirrhosis is the condition that results when a chronic health problem affecting the liver has progressed to its final stage of scarring (fibrosis). If the condition advances unchecked, it can lead to liver failure. WebApr 10, 2024 · April 10, 2024. By Liz Switzer. The Duke Liver Transplant Program this spring marks 2,000 transplants with patient outcomes that are among the best in the nation for key metrics such as shorter transplant wait times and one-year survival. While median wait time for a liver transplant in the U.S. is about 240 days, Duke’s wait time is 85 days.
